Strand Bookstore Union Negotiations in Cartoon Format

Cartoonist Greg Farrell has drawn a cartoon strip about union contract negotiations at the Strand Bookstore.
Earlier this month, union members at the New York City bookstore voted to reject a contract proposal from the famous bookstore. Follow this link to see the complete comic strip.
The New York Times has more about the negotiations: “The workers, along with the Strand’s roughly 140 other union workers, had just concluded a four-day vote on the management’s latest contract offer. As expected, it was rejected because many of the employees felt that it would have significantly reduced their benefits.” (Via The Awl)
